Does PuTTY support SSH v2?

0

Yes. SSH v2 support has been available in PuTTY since version 0.50. However, currently the default SSH protocol is v1; to select SSH v2 if your server supports both, go to the SSH panel and change the Preferred SSH protocol version option. Public key authentication (both RSA and DSA) in SSH v2 is new in version 0.52.
